Class D, 20 W × 2-channel (BTL) Low-Frequency Power Amplifier IC
The TB2924FG is an audio output IC that employs the highly
efficient class D method, developed for TV and home audio
applications.
The TB2924FG eliminates the need for heatsink
allowing the design of an end product with a small footprint. It
also incorporates a range of features, such as standby and muting,
as well as different protective circuits.
